Trending Topics
Source: Overheard on CT (tg: @overheardonct), Kaito
MYSHELL: Today, MYSHELL has become the focus of discussion as Binance took action against a market maker suspected of improper conduct with MYSHELL and GPS. Binance delisted the market maker, banned further activity, and confiscated profits to compensate affected users.
FARCASTER: Farcaster has garnered attention for its integration with Coinbase Wallet, enabling seamless on-chain transactions and the development of AI agents without rate limits. The platform's permissionless environment and supportive community are attracting developers and users, with feature enhancements like Warpcast Wallet and Frames v2 improving the user experience. Farcaster is also seen as a promising platform to onboard initial users and engage in high-quality content, with its weekly reward program further driving this development.
PENGU: Today, discussions around $PENGU have focused on Pudgy Penguins' community involvement, including the latest from the Inner Igloo conference, which announced upcoming integrations of $PENGU into PudgyWorld and AbstractChain, among other developments. The community is excited about $PENGU's potential as a social currency, despite recent price drops, with many expressing bullish sentiment. The discussion also highlighted the increasing number of $PENGU holders and active community participation in events such as virtual conferences and NFT collaborations.
GPS: Today, discussions about GPS primarily focused on Binance's action against a market maker involved in improper conduct with GPS and the SHELL project. Binance has expelled the market maker, seized their profits, and plans to use these funds to compensate affected users. This move has been widely discussed as a positive step to uphold market integrity and protect investors. The community also speculates on the identity of the market maker and the broader impact of Binance's actions on the cryptocurrency market.

Binance Research: RWA Market Expected to Expand Nearly 6x from Early 2025, with Public Equities and Onchain Payments Heating Up Together
In June, Binance Research said in its monthly market report that the real-world asset (RWA) market is expected to grow by about 589% from the beginning of 2025. Bond- and money market fund-related RWA expanded by about $6.5 billion, up 83% year over year, while publicly traded equity RWAs grew by about 422%. The report also noted that monthly crypto debit card transaction volume exceeded $747 million in May, up 48.6% year to date.

Japan to Assess a Framework for Yen Stablecoins and Crypto ETFs as Asia’s Compliant Payments Narrative Heats Up
Recently, according to the original report, Japan is considering the launch of yen stablecoins and cryptocurrency ETFs. Public information remains limited at this stage, and there is still no complete policy text, regulatory draft, or clear implementation timeline, so this is better characterized as a “policy discussion” rather than formal implementation. The original wording also noted that advancing stablecoin regulation in Asia is driving XRP usage and supporting growth in the XRPL ecosystem. However, based on currently available public information, there is not enough evidence to directly establish a clear causal relationship between this round of discussion in Japan and XRP or XRPL.

Foreign selling in the South Korean stock market accelerates, with cumulative net sales reportedly reaching $75 billion this year
On June 9, The Kobeissi Letter, citing Goldman Sachs data, reported that global investors are selling South Korean stocks at an unusually rapid pace. In the latest trading session, foreign investors sold about $801 million worth of Kospi constituent stocks again; total foreign outflows last week reached about $10 billion, and the market has been in net foreign selling on nearly every trading day over the past month. According to the data cited in the report, foreign investors have sold about $75 billion worth of South Korean stocks so far this year. Meanwhile, South Korean retail and institutional investors together recorded roughly $69 billion in net buying over the same period, suggesting that the market’s main buying support has come from domestic capital rather than returning overseas funds. The information currently disclosed still mainly comes from The Kobeissi Letter’s retelling and Goldman Sachs data summaries, while public details on the statistical period and the specific definition of “selling” remain relatively limited.
